MEMORANDUM OPINION[1] AND JUDGMENT

On November 19, 2010, we notified appellants that their brief had not been filed as required by Texas Rule of Appellate Procedure 38.6(a).  See Tex. R. App. P. 38.6(a).  We stated we could dismiss the appeal for want of prosecution unless appellants or any party desiring to continue this appeal filed with the court within ten days a response showing grounds for continuing the appeal.  See Tex. R. App. P. 38.8(a)(1).  We have not received any response.

Because appellants' brief has not been filed, we dismiss the appeal for want of prosecution.  See Tex. R. App. P. 38.8(a)(1), 42.3(b), 43.2(f).

Appellants shall pay all costs of this appeal, for which let execution issue.
